    Rayna A.

    A hug to the gut. Tantan, Shoyu, Shio, vegan and meat options - something for everyone. If you want a comfy bowl of goodness on a cold Portland day, eat here. This place can get crazy busy - be prepared to wait to be seated. No reservations! You also may end up outside but covered. They have table service inside and the outdoor area is covered. It's not really about the buzzing scene for me - It's more about getting that Ramen in my belly. This is in my top three Ramen spots, for Portland. I tried almost all of their Ramen and my favorite is the vegan TanTan with chicken. The chicken is ground and soaks up the broth well. The teens in my life like to the shiyo, potstickers and cheese cake. Protip: $3 taco Tuesday's. Also, pay attention to the heat level on the TanTan ramen because even mild warms the tongue and belly. It's my kinda warm in it comes on just as quick as it leaves. But if you want to burn - just tell your server to make it spicy.

    Deedee C.

    Great outdoor seating vibe even on a weekday evening. Came here to try their vegan ramens since last time I tried their non-veg ones, which were also really good. My partner and I ordered their mala and curry vegan ramen and mole tofu tacos. The mole tacos were a nice fusion snack, and packed some good flavor. But that mala ramen was special and had the kind of flavor that makes you want to eat more. I wasn't hungry and I ended up almost finishing the entire bowl! The broth flavor had a touch of that Sichuan peppercorn flavor and coated the noodles perfectly. And love the quantity and flavor of the marinated tofu they add to substitute for the Cha Shu. The curry ramen was also pretty good though mala was a lot more of my style I will definitely be back for another bowl

    I came here for lunch and got the tantan ramen (from lots of friends recommendations). It was my first time at Kayo's Ramen Bar, the staff let me know I could take a menu and sit wherever I'd like then come to the front to order. With the tantan ramen you can pick your spice level, I just picked the mild and got the spicy sauce on the side. The tantan ramen was okay, nothing too special. It did have the flavors of tantan. Good amount of ground pork, nice soup broth flavor (a bit salty for me). I liked the addition of the leafy greens, and glad I added a seasoned egg. Not many toppings on this ramen but it's flavorful and I like its simplicity. There's street parking available, easier to find some parking in the neighborhood around here. This is a nice spot to get a quick meal, to meet with friends or have a meal alone. Great food for cooler weather too! Next time, I'll try their other ramens such as shio, shoyu or miso.

    This no-frills ramen shop is a fantastic, comforting destination that's especially cozy on a rainy…read morePortland day. The kitchen brings out steaming bowls incredibly fast, filled with rich broths and excellent toppings with an efficient, straightforward dining style. Tonkotsu Shoyu (4/5): A deeply comforting and classic bowl of ramen. They offer a generous portion of perfectly cooked noodles paired with plenty of fresh vegetables like spinach, green onions, and mushrooms. The soft-boiled egg was perfectly yolky, but the dish would've been elevated even further with a slightly more generous serving of chashu pork. Tonkotsu Red (5/5): A unique variation for those who love a bit of heat. It shares the same chewy noodle and vegetable foundation as the Shoyu, but has a spicy broth that builds and ramps up the more you slurp. The heat was a distinct, subtle numbing sensation reminding me of Sichuan peppercorns, creating an incredibly flavorful and unique twist on a traditional tonkotsu base. Logistics Tip: This is a fast and casual self-service setup where you walk right up to the counter upon entering to order from the menu displayed on the wall. Indoor seating is limited to a few long, communal tables, so be prepared to potentially share space with other diners during peak hours, and remember to bus your own dishes when finished. For parking, street spots are easy to find and can be paid for using the local Parking Kitty app.
